xfs: reinstate the old i_version counter as STATX_CHANGE_COOKIE

The handling of STATX_CHANGE_COOKIE was moved into generic_fillattr in
commit 0d72b92883c6 (fs: pass the request_mask to generic_fillattr), but
we didn't account for the fact that xfs doesn't call generic_fillattr at
all.

Make XFS report its i_version as the STATX_CHANGE_COOKIE.

Fixes: 0d72b92883c6 (fs: pass the request_mask to generic_fillattr)
Signed-off-by: Jeff Layton <jlayton@kernel.org>
---
I had hoped to fix this in a better way with the multigrain patches, but
it's taking longer than expected (if it even pans out at this point).

Until then, make sure we use XFS's i_version as the STATX_CHANGE_COOKIE,
even if it's bumped due to atime updates. Too many invalidations is
preferable to not enough.

Oh!   Right, this is needed because the "hide a state in the high bit of
tv_nsec" stuff got reverted in -rc3, correct?  So now nfsd needs some
way to know that something changed in the file, and better to have too
many client invalidations than not enough?  And I guess bumping
i_version will keep nfsd sane for now?

diff --git a/fs/xfs/xfs_iops.c b/fs/xfs/xfs_iops.c
index 1c1e6171209d..2b3b05c28e9e 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/xfs_iops.c
+++ b/fs/xfs/xfs_iops.c
@@ -584,6 +584,11 @@  xfs_vn_getattr(
 		}
 	}
 
+	if ((request_mask & STATX_CHANGE_COOKIE) && IS_I_VERSION(inode)) {
+		stat->change_cookie = inode_query_iversion(inode);
+		stat->result_mask |= STATX_CHANGE_COOKIE;
+	}
+
 	/*
 	 * Note: If you add another clause to set an attribute flag, please
 	 * update attributes_mask below.
